Dr Shih E’ Ching is a Consultant with the Department of Otolaryngology – Head & Neck Surgery in NUH. She is trained in all aspects of general ear, nose, and throat conditions. Her special interest is in paediatric otolaryngology.
After obtaining her medical degree from the Yong Loo Lin School of Medicine, National University of Singapore in 2011, Dr Shih attained membership to the Royal College of Surgeons, MRCS (Edinburgh) in 2014 and completed her postgraduate ACGME-I accredited ENT training with the National University Hospital Residency Program in 2018. She was awarded the Health Manpower Development Plan Fellowship in 2022 and completed the ACGME-accredited fellowship from 2024 to 2025 in Paediatric Otolaryngology at Mass Eye and Ear, Mass General Brigham Hospital, the primary teaching hospital affiliate of Harvard Medical School, United States of America.
Besides caring for patients, Dr Shih also enjoys teaching undergraduate and post-graduate students as an Adjunct Assistant Professor with the Yong Loo Lin School of Medicine, National University of Singapore.
